Pull pin control fixes from Linus Walleij:
 "This deals with a crash in the Qualcomm pin controller GPIO
  parts when using hogs.

  The first patch to gpiolib makes gpiochip_line_is_valid()
  NULL-tolerant.

  The second patch fixes the actual problem"

* tag 'pinctrl-v6.15-4' of git://git.kernel.org/pub/scm/linux/kernel/git/linusw/linux-pinctrl:
  pinctrl: qcom: switch to devm_register_sys_off_handler()
  gpiolib: don't crash on enabling GPIO HOG pins

@@ -742,6 +742,12 @@ EXPORT_SYMBOL_GPL(gpiochip_query_valid_mask);
bool gpiochip_line_is_valid(const struct gpio_chip *gc,
				unsigned int offset)
{
	/*
	 * hog pins are requested before registering GPIO chip
	 */
	if (!gc->gpiodev)
		return true;

	/* No mask means all valid */
	if (likely(!gc->gpiodev->valid_mask))
		return true;
